About Clarence Town 2321

The size of Clarence Town is approximately 91.9 square kilometres. It has 4 parks covering nearly 41.7% of total area. The population of Clarence Town in 2016 was 1994 people. By 2021 the population was 2265 showing a population growth of 13.6%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Clarence Town is 50-59 years. Households in Clarence Town are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Clarence Town work in a trades occupation.In 2021, 88.60% of the homes in Clarence Town were owner-occupied compared with 86.70% in 2016.

Clarence Town has 1,128 properties. Over the last 5 years, Houses in Clarence Town have seen a 79.45% increase in median value, while Units have seen a 83.16% increase. As at 30 November 2025:

  • The median value for Houses in Clarence Town is $1,041,395 while the median value for Units is $517,393.
  • Houses have a median rent of $620.
There are currently 11 properties listed for sale, and 2 properties listed for rent in Clarence town on OnTheHouse. According to Cotality's data, 53 properties were sold in the past 12 months in Clarence town.
